emucheese Posted March 10, 2017 Share Posted March 10, 2017 (edited) Hello, Firstly, not sure if this is in the right section so apologies if not! I've got a 2015 Ford Focus zetec and until today it's been working beautifully. The problem I'm getting is when I get in the car plug the phone in and turn on the ignition it starts charging and connecting to either music or Spotify, after a few seconds however, it'll say USB 1 (or 2, depending on the port) device removed. But it'll definitely still be plugged in. It then stops charging the phone. ive tried removing and plugging it back in with absolutely nothing happening (no charging or sync notifications) on either USB port. The only way I can get to do anything is by turning the ignition off, opening the door, closing the door and turning the ignition back on, but then I'm back to square one with the disconnecting after 5-10 secconds. I've also tried a sync master reset with no luck and the issue still occuring. Im really hoping someone here can help as it used to be working like a dream! Thanks in advance! emucheese Posted March 28, 2017 Author Share Posted March 28, 2017 Hello, Just incase anyone else comes across this issue, I've managed to fix it :D I pulled the fuse for the sync module (fuse 67 if I recall, in the passenger footwell), powered on the car and pressed the radio power button(didn't work because of the lack of a fuse...) turned the car off and opened the driver door, put the fuse back in and bosh, USB ports working again.
